Please help, i keep seeing Basket.Load but cannot find it.  I want to update
existing orders but i DO NOT want to overwrite one's existing cart if they
have one.  How do i do this.  I want to update shipping and billing address,
cc info and line items qty.

Hi Jeremy,

Basket.Load is to create an instance of the user's basket based on what is
stored in the Database. Basket.Add on the other hand is used to add the
contents of a OrderTemplate or PurchaseOrder into the existing user basket.

If you're using Retail2002 site then you'll be able to locate the
Basket.Load call in the TransactionContext Class  otherwise Basket.Load ca
n
be found in the documentation at
http://msdn.microsoft.com/library/?....asp?frame=true

If you do not want to override the existing cart then you should create an
OrderTemplate,  move the contents of the cart into that OrderTemplate, Save
it. Clear the basket, load the PO, make modifications, save the PO, clear th
e
cart, load the OrderTemaplate, save the basket & delete the OrderTemplate
